## Deployment

This release replaces the homegrown Quenby job queue with the Relayline broker. Workers no longer poll the jobs table; they subscribe to named channels, and the old cron-based sweeper has been removed entirely. Reviewers should verify that the migration script drains in-flight jobs before cutover and that dead-letter handling matches the previous retry semantics. Rollback is a single flag flip. The worker pods deploy with the following configuration values:

config for kafof-bawef:
holath:
  log_level: debug
  metrics_host: metrics.holath.qorvelsys.internal
  pin: 2191
  pool_size: 32

// Support note: Verdanta greenhouse humidity sensors drift upward
// roughly 0.4% per week after calibration. This constant is the
// weekly correction applied by the controller loop. Do NOT raise it
// past 0.6 without a bench recalibration — overcorrection closes
// vents prematurely. If a site reports fogging, check firmware first.
// Quote the build token below when opening a hardware case.

session token of tajef-bageg = htk21_5d90d574934f3ccae6437

Leadership Review Briefing — Legacy Pricing

Quick heads-up for branch managers: we're moving legacy Fernbright subscribers onto the current rate card starting next quarter. Roughly 4,200 accounts are affected, mostly on plans untouched since the Clearline era. Expect some pushback — retention scripts and goodwill credits are being prepared. Before the review, please read the confidential planning note appended just below.

internal memo for kawip-hadug: Headcount on the Wenwyn team goes from 7 to 140 by the end of January. Gross margin on Wenwyn came in at 20 percent against a plan of 15 percent.